    The con in Condoleezza
     
    "It was not a mistake to overthrow Saddam Hussein... it was not a mistake to unleash the forces of democracy in the Middle East", said Condoleezza. How we chortled.

    "Democracy is the only system that allows people to be heard and be heard peacefully," she said. Oh, how we laughed.

    The use of force "is not what is on the agenda now" in the stand-off over Iran's nuclear programme, she told us. Guffaws all round.

    Ms Rice thanked "the citizens and the government of Great Britain for the willingness to share in the sacrifices for freedom". Merry uproar.

    The Dean of Blackburn said her visit would "promote peace and justice in the global community." Hilarious! And Jack Straw said, "Everything we are doing on the visit is being done with respect to the communities involved." Boy, we split our sides.

    Condoleezza, with us here on April the First, with line after line of carefully-prepared japes. Sister - you nearly had us fooled!!
